Kerry Lee Art
Kerry Lee was educated at Reading Schools of Arts and Science, the Slade and the Paris-Sorbonne University. Lee subsequently assisted his step-father, an architect named Mr. Harvey, as a draftsman. Following the Depression, Lee set up Associated Artists' at Blandford Studios off Baker Street, with a group of other commercial artists. During World War II, he was based in Hertfordshire and created detailed cut-away drawings of German aircraft. After the war, Lee was still at Blandford Studios and published a series of pictorial maps, both those as Travel Posters for British Railways and also as his own publications.
